## Env vars: Squatwatch scanner

Squatwatch scans internal manifests for typo-squatted package names. Required: SQUATWATCH_REGISTRY_MIRROR=internal, SQUATWATCH_SCAN_INTERVAL=15m, SQUATWATCH_FAIL_BUILD=true. Runs in CI only; do not enable locally. The scanner authenticates to the registry mirror with a token, set on the line directly below:

secret setting of yajog-taguf: ARCHIVE_KEY3=051

Ticket: Vault lockout — DedupeDeck config

Hey folks, quick one for the newer people on Team Lanternfish. The vault holding DedupeDeck's suppression rules locked itself after three bad unlock attempts during last night's page storm. This happens more than you'd think. Don't panic and don't re-key anything — the deduplicator keeps running on its cached ruleset. To reopen the vault you just need the recovery passphrase, which is noted right below.

recovery phrase for bawep-kawef: oliath-casdor

Subject: Licensing dispute update — please read

Hi all,

Quick heads-up for branch managers: the disagreement with Fennick Labs over the Cobalt Suite licence is now in formal mediation. Keep selling as normal, but don't commit to multi-year renewals on affected modules until we have clarity. Questions go through me, not the branches. The sensitive planning detail is noted directly below.

board note of fahif-yahog: Gross margin on Wenath came in at 10 percent against a plan of 5 percent. Only 3 of the 100 pilot accounts renewed Wenath, so a churn review is set for July 15.

# GraphScope renders dependency graphs for the Lintbarrow build system.
# If you're new: layout quality depends heavily on these constants, so
# please read the layout notes in docs/ before changing anything. Node
# spacing interacts with edge-bundling strength in non-obvious ways, and
# values that look fine on small graphs can collapse badly at 5k+ nodes.
# We validated the current set against the Harrowfen monorepo snapshot.
# The tuning constants follow below.

constants for fajop-tahaf:
RATE_LIMITS = {
    "holael": 2,
    "oliael": 10,
    "druael": 10,
    "wenwyn": 10,
}